Section 5705.17 - [repealed Effective 7/17/1995 by H.b. 249, 121st General Assembly] Transfer Funds for General Assistance
In addition to sections 5705.14 and 5705.15 of the Revised Code, and any other sections of the Revised Code relating to the transfer of funds between subdivisions, the board of county commissioners of any county, the council or other legislative authority of any municipal corporation, and the trustees of any township, not furnishing general assistance, upon a vote of two-thirds of the members of the board of county commissioners of any county, the council of any municipal corporation, or the board of trustees of any township may transfer general assistance funds, or any other funds not otherwise appropriated, to the county, municipal corporation, or townships furnishing general assistance; provided that transfers by the board of county commissioners shall be to municipal corporations or townships located within the county, transfers by township trustees shall be to the county in which the township is located or to municipal corporations located wholly or in part within the township, and transfers by a municipal corporation shall be to the county or the township in which such municipal corporation is located in whole or in part. Immediately upon receipt of notice of the action of the legislative authority transferring funds, the officer of the political subdivision making such transer who is charged with the duty of distributing its funds shall make distribution in accordance therewith.
Funds received pursuant to any transfer under this section shall be credited to the general assistance fund of the transferee subdivision and shall be expended solely for the purposes of general assistance.
This section does not mean that any subdivision may transfer to any other subdivision funds for assistance purposes that the transferring subdivision may not expend in its own subdivision for purposes of assistance.
